What is just compensation?

Just compensation is a term most commonly used in expropriation cases, and is defined "as the
full and fair equivalent of the property taken from its owner by the expropriator. The Supreme
Court has pronounced it the true measure of such as not the taker's gain but the owner's loss.
Further, the word 'just' is used to modify the meaning of the word 'compensation' to convey the
idea that the equivalent to be given for the property to be taken shall be real, substantial, full and
ample. [Apo Fruits Corporation v. Land Bank of the Philippines. 647 Phil. 251 (2010)]
 
Which agencies make the determination of the value of the land?

The initial land valuation computations are made by the Land Bank of the Philippines (LBP) and
the Department of Agrarian Reform (DAR), and in doing so they must follow administrative
orders and other issuances of the DAR Secretary and LBP. After such, preliminary proceedings
of land valuation for the purpose of the determining just compensation for acquisition is then
conducted by the Provincial Agrarian Reform Adjudicators (PARAD), Regional Agrarian
Reform Adjudicators (RARAD), and Department of Agrarian Reform Adjudication Board
(DARAB) of the DAR. Adjudicator is assigned based on the initial land valuation. For lands
with initial land valuation of less than P10,000,000.00, preliminary proceedings shall be
conducted by the PARAD. For lands with initial land valuation of less than P50,000,000.00,
preliminary proceedings shall be conducted by the RARAD. For lands with initial land valuation
of more than P50,000,000.00, preliminary proceedings shall be conducted by the DARAB. [Rule
XIX, Secs. 1-2, 2009 DARAB Rules of Procedure]
 
What is the role of the special agrarian court in the determination of just compensation?

An action may be filed by a party who disagrees with the valuation of the Board or Adjudicator,
with the Special Agrarian Court (SAC) having jurisdiction over the subject property. The SAC
for final determination of just compensation, it serves as a forum of last resort for those who
desire for a re-computation of just compensation. [Rule XIX, Sec. 6, 2009 DARAB Rules of
Procedure]
